Transaction 8109ea761f1327812b08521df5e9e65de42b6b77287e4a05732851db1075a1cc

2 Input
1 Outputs
  • 8109ea761f1327812b08521df5e9e65de42b6b77287e4a05732851db1075a1cc:0
  • value  242068
    address  3CNCgZrJWBCCSeJXPGfEohxyhuw1Q8v4H5